    Good hardware, bad software

    The phone counts on paper with good specifications, but a series of failures at the ROM level do not recommend it in my opinion. With an early version of Android M (v.123) the gyroscope did not work well for the automatic rotation of the screen. In later versions they corrected this but other worse problems appeared: If the apps are not anchored in the application manager, the system closes them in a short time and the notifications are no longer received (eg whatsapp ....). And under a certain combination, the micro stops working in calls, it only works by putting the speaker.

    Good mobile, I would buy it again

    The mobile is nice, although it scratches easily. But I've fallen a lot of times, and I do not pick it up and it's like new. The battery is a joy, the camera is very good, both with light and at night, with very good colors. The flash could be more powerful, the front camera is good and has flash that is the screen, and good photos come out. I have not had any problems with power. Of coverage I have pleasant, and sometimes it is short, the wifi great. I have not updated the software, because it goes better with the old version

    Pretty good but with some lack mobile

    Battery is very good, do not worry about recharging. Design like all beautiful Nubians. Fails ROM, to a few hours stops turning, but not hardware failure, the sensor continues to operate but applications do not rotate, if you restart works but fails to little while, there are many user reviews on forums complaining about the same , hopefully Nubia quick update. Light camera fine, but at night or in low light I was disappointed muuuucho noise and focus is not very fast, the front camera bad.

    bestial autonomy, something improved performance

    I take a few days with but for now it seems a wise purchase. My biggest problem has always been the battery, this have come to be a whole day using it and go to sleep still had 30% battery approx. very good in resistance as resolution screen, vivid colors, very good pictures in daylight but at night it loses a bit. Initially you have the option of recording video at 120fps slow camera but the quality of it seems to 144p. It comes with Nubia layer which adds a few features and options for gestures that are interesting but I think not optimized at all, notifications fail occasionally. Its weakest point is the processor, for daily use does not have to cause problems but with more powerful apps resists a bit. The fingerprint reader has not given me any problems, easily recognized (perhaps too that makes screenshots inadvertently xD)

What is a Ki score?
Ki is an automatic score based on the specifications and prices of devices. It is calculated using over 200 variables to rank smartphones, tablets and other devices from best to worst.
How do we calculate the Ki?

In this case, to determine the score we evaluate 5 general aspects:

  • Design and screen
  • Hardware and performance
  • Camera
  • Connectivity
  • Battery

Once these 5 factors have been rated, we introduce the price variable. This means that any two devices with the same ratings get a different Ki score for quality vs price.

Even a device objectively worse than another may have a higher Ki score if it has a better price.

Does the Ki score change?

The Ki varies as time goes by. As new devices with better specifications enter the market the Ki score of older devices will go down, always being compensated of their decrease in price.
